San Andreas Captures Tunku Gold Cup

San Andreas as a yearling.

New Zealand Bloodstock Ready to Run Sale graduate San Andreas (Smart Missile) landed the biggest win of his career with an impressive come-from-behind performance in Sunday’s RM150,000 Equine Sanctuary Tunku Gold Cup (1200m) at Selangor.

San Andreas was offered by Kilgravin Lodge at the 2018 Ready to Run Sale, where he was purchased for $90,000 by Alrashid Group. His 23-start career has now produced eight wins and four second placings, earning more than RM230,000 in prize-money.

Sunday’s Tunku Gold Cup was the six-year-old’s first win at black-type level, and he earned it in impressive style.

Ridden by Brazilian jockey Edson Teixeira Ferreira, San Andreas dropped back from his wide gate and settled at the rear of the 16-horse field.  He was still second-last rounding the home turn, but then he quickened brilliantly and ducked and weaved his way through traffic down the Selangor straight.

With a withering late burst, he flashed past the front-running favourite Awesome Storm (Phenomenons) and won by half a length. The 1200 metres were run in 1:09.47.

San Andreas is owned by Box Office and is trained by AB Abdullah.
